X-Git-Url: http://git.rot13.org/?p=BackupPC.git;a=blobdiff_plain;f=bin%2FBackupPC_dump;h=f47b6e3a505fc8a7a1d749be49778732d5e3a876;hp=4472b233fe860f2351e3139d68d83ffb5db19011;hb=refs%2Ftags%2Fv3_0_0beta1;hpb=e6fc5dc667cbf97c374da04c55d24e4ea83ec865 diff --git a/bin/BackupPC_dump b/bin/BackupPC_dump index 4472b23..f47b6e3 100755 --- a/bin/BackupPC_dump +++ b/bin/BackupPC_dump @@ -70,7 +70,7 @@ # #======================================================================== # -# Version 3.0.0beta0, released 11 Jul 2006. +# Version 3.0.0beta1, released 30 Jul 2006. # # See http://backuppc.sourceforge.net. # @@ -86,6 +86,7 @@ use BackupPC::Xfer::Smb; use BackupPC::Xfer::Tar; use BackupPC::Xfer::Rsync; use BackupPC::Xfer::BackupPCd; +use Encode; use Socket; use File::Path; use File::Find; @@ -581,6 +582,10 @@ $NeedPostCmd = 1; for my $shareName ( @$ShareNames ) { local(*RH, *WH); + # + # Convert $shareName to utf8 octets + # + $shareName = encode("utf8", $shareName); $stat{xferOK} = $stat{hostAbort} = undef; $stat{hostError} = $stat{lastOutputLine} = undef; if ( -d "$Dir/new/$shareName" ) {